jQuery.jsonp.js是一款支持跨域请求的jQuery插件,它的作用是在前端将jsonp请求封装起来,使得跨域请求变得更加方便和简单。
使用jQuery.jsonp.js前,需要先引入jQuery库。然后在页面中引入jquery.jsonp.js文件。
<-- 引入jQuery库 --><script src="https://cdn.bootcss.com/jquery/3.6.0/jquery.min.js"></script><-- 引入jquery.jsonp.js --><script src="jquery.jsonp.js"></script>
接下来便是使用jQuery.jsonp.js进行跨域请求。下面是一个例子:
<script>$.jsonp({ url: "https://api.github.com/users/qinghua/repos", callbackParameter: "callback", success: function (data) { console.log(data); }, error: function (d,msg) { console.log("Error: "+msg); } }); </script>
使用$.jsonp({})方法,我们可以设置请求的url、回调函数名、成功处理函数和错误处理函数。
总的来说,jQuery.jsonp.js就是能够做到前端跨域请求的一款功能强大的jQuery插件,它允许在任何网站上发送GET请求,并将结果嵌入到任何页面中。因此,我们在开发前端跨站应用程序时,可以大大减少代码的复杂性。